Governor Anandiben Patel Inaugurates New Branch of Lucknow Public School in Bareilly

Lucknow: Uttar Pradesh Governor Anandiben Patel inaugurated a new branch of Lucknow Public School in Bareilly, underscoring the importance of quality and inclusive education in shaping the nation’s future.

Addressing the gathering, the Governor lauded the initiative by the school’s founder S P Singh Baghel, calling it a commendable step toward strengthening the education sector in the district. She emphasized the need to equip students with skills and knowledge to face global challenges, stressing the importance of technical education, modern curricula, teacher training, and skill development.

Highlighting the transformative role of education, she said that it should go beyond textbooks to include value-based learning. “Teachers are not just educators but architects of the nation’s future,” she remarked, adding that India must strive to reclaim its position as a global knowledge leader.

The Governor also spoke about the importance of inclusive education, urging institutions to extend opportunities to underprivileged children. She appealed to the school management to provide free education to at least five children from slum areas, stating that true progress is achieved when education reaches the last mile.

Referring to ongoing welfare initiatives, she noted that efforts under the “Jan Bhavan” initiative are helping identify and support children from disadvantaged backgrounds by providing them with platforms to grow. She also appreciated the arrangement made for distributing two sets of uniforms to 500 students.

Stressing the need for outreach, she encouraged universities to extend their expertise beyond campuses to villages, benefiting farmers, youth, and women. She also called for a balanced focus on academic growth and moral values, noting that education plays a key role in addressing the erosion of family values in modern times.

The event featured cultural performances by students, showcasing themes of communal harmony and patriotism, which were appreciated by the Governor. She also distributed chocolates and fruits among the children, encouraging them to pursue their goals with dedication.

The ceremony was attended by Mayor Dr Umesh Gautam, District Panchayat Chairperson Rashmi Patel, Vice-Chancellor K P Singh, former MLC and administrator Kranti Singh, Managing Director Sushil Kumar, General Manager Shikhar Pal Singh, and Harshit Singh, along with other dignitaries, students, and parents.
